Understanding the B1 Level (CEFR)
The Common European Framework of Reference for Languages (CEFR) specifies the B1 level as the "threshold" or intermediate stage. A candidate at this level is thought about an "independent user." According to the CEFR guidelines, people who attain a B1 level need to be able to:
Understand the main points of clear basic input on familiar matters frequently encountered in work, school, or leisure.Offer with most situations most likely to arise while traveling in an area where the language is spoken.Produce easy linked text on topics that recognize or of individual interest.Describe experiences and events, dreams, hopes, and aspirations and briefly provide reasons and explanations for viewpoints and strategies.The Structure of the telc B1 Examination
The telc B1 examination is carefully developed to evaluate all 4 core language abilities: reading, listening, composing, and speaking. Furthermore, unlike some other structures, telc includes a particular concentrate on "Language Elements," which assesses grammar and vocabulary in context.

The examination is divided into two primary parts: the Written Examination and the Oral Examination.
Table 1: Breakdown of the B1 telc Exam ComponentsModuleSub-SectionDurationFocus AreaWritten ExamChecking out Comprehension90 MinutesGlobal, selective, and in-depth reading.Language Elements(Included in Reading)Grammar, vocabulary, and syntax.ListeningApprox. 30 MinutesGlobal, selective, and in-depth listening.Written Expression30 MinutesSemi-formal or official letter/email.Oral ExamSpeakingApprox. 15 MinutesPresentation, conversation, and preparation.
Keep in mind: The Reading and Language Elements areas are normally administered together within a 90-minute block.
Detailed Analysis of Exam Modules1. Checking Out and Language Elements
Candidates find themselves tasked with analyzing numerous text types, ranging from newspaper ads to helpful posts. The "Language Elements" part is especially vital; it typically consists of multiple-choice cloze tests (filling in the blanks) that need a nuanced understanding of prepositions, verb conjugations, and common idioms.
2. Listening
The listening module uses audio recordings of everyday conversations, announcements, and radio segments. Candidates need to demonstrate the capability to capture both the basic essence and specific information under time pressure. The problem lies in the reality that some recordings are played only once, needing high levels of concentration.
3. Writing
In this section, prospects are generally required to react to a timely by composing a letter or an email. This may include a complaint, an ask for info, or a formalized RSVP. The examiners search for appropriate structure (salutation, body, closing), proper use of tenses, and sensible coherence.
4. Speaking
The oral test is generally conducted in pairs. It includes 3 parts:
Part 1: Getting to know each other. A short introductory exchange.Part 2: Discussing a topic. Candidates talk about a particular experience or opinion based on a brief text.Part 3: Planning something together. Prospects should connect to arrange an event, such as a trip or a party.Scoring and Grading Criteria
To pass the B1 telc test, a prospect should perform adequately in both the composed and oral areas. Particularly, they should achieve a minimum of 60% of the maximum possible points in each section.
Table 2: telc B1 Grading ScaleRating (%)Grade (German Equivalent)Grade (English Translation)90-- 100%Sehr GutGreat80-- 89.5%GutGood70-- 79.5%BefriedigendAcceptable60-- 69.5%AusreichendAdequate (Pass)0-- 59.5%Nicht BestandenFail
If a candidate passes only one part (either the composed or the oral), they may be eligible to bring that result over for a limited time and retake only the stopped working part.
Strategic Preparation for the B1 telc
Success in the B1 telc test is hardly ever the result of luck. It requires a structured approach to study and an understanding of the exam format. The following strategies are often advised by language trainers:
Essential Preparation Steps:Familiarization with Format: Candidates need to make use of "Model Tests" (Modellsätze) provided by telc Gmbh. This assists in comprehending the pacing and the kinds of questions asked.Vocabulary Expansion: Focus needs to be put on high-frequency [B1 Zertifikat](http://asresin.cn/home.php?mod=space&uid=649803) vocabulary, particularly ports (e.g., weil, obwohl, trotzdem) which elevate the quality of both writing and speaking.Immersion: Listening to podcasts, watching news segments in the target language (such as Logo! or Deutsche Welle), and checking out local papers can bridge the space in between book knowing and real-world application.Time Management: During practice sessions, test-takers must strictly comply with the time limits of each module to construct the essential endurance.Tips for the Writing Section:Use a Template: Memorizing basic formal greetings and closings guarantees that basic points are secured.Point-by-Point Addressing: The prompt normally contains 3 or 4 "bullet points." Candidates need to address each and every single point to get complete marks for material.Check for Minor Errors: Reserved time at the end permits examining gender-case endings and verb positions.Why Choose telc Over Other Certificates?

Often Asked Questions (FAQ)
1. The length of time is the B1 telc certificate legitimate?The certificate remains legitimate forever. Unlike some expert accreditations, telc language certificates do not end. However, some companies or federal government firms might request a certificate that is no more than two years old to ensure current proficiency.

2. Can the test be taken online?Currently, the B1 telc test must be taken in individual at a licensed screening center to guarantee the stability of the assessment procedure, particularly for the oral and listening elements.

3. What occurs if a candidate stops working just the oral or the written part?If a candidate passes one part however fails the other, they can retake just the stopped working area. This need to generally be done within the same fiscal year or by the end of the next calendar year to integrate the results.

4. Just how much does the B1 telc test cost?The expense varies depending upon the screening center and the nation. In Germany, the cost usually ranges in between EUR130 and EUR190.

5. The length of time does it take to get the results?Usually, it takes between 4 to six weeks for telc to grade the documents and send the main certificate to the screening center.
